Pecos County borders Reeves County, Ward County, Brewster County, and Crane County. Crews routinely work across a county line without it changing anything legally: a move from Pecos County into any of those is still an intrastate Texas move under the same operating authority. What it can change is the bill, because most companies put drive time on the clock.

Do I need an interstate mover for a move inside Pecos County?
No. A move that starts and ends inside Pecos County is an intrastate move covered by Texas authority. Federal USDOT household-goods authority only becomes the requirement once a move crosses a state line, however short the drive.
